Sous Chef - Taverne on Woodlake - Destination Kohler

Work Mode: Onsite

Location: Kohler, WI

Opportunity

The Sous Chef at Taverne on Woodlake is responsible for leading the day to day culinary operation. Must meet the requirements of the department ensuring product quality, service standards and profit goals are met or exceeded. Supervise the daily ordering, receiving, and proper handling of product, develop new menu ideas, train and develop staff to ensure that all products represent standards.

Control food & labor costs and supervise the daily preparation of all products and ensure that standard operating procedures are followed. Strive to move the business and its cuisine forward to be competitive in its market nitch.

Specific Responsibilities

  • Standardize recipes, plating instructions and menu costs.

  • Monitor freshness and inspect food products daily to uphold quality standards of the resort.

  • Work closely with the Inventory manager and purchasing to source best quality at best price amongst food vendors.

  • Engage daily in the preparation of food to ensure execution and quality standards are met.Ensure sanitation guidelines are met daily.

  • Monitor sales mix reports monthly.

  • Create specials and work with management to execute special events and marketing opportunities.

  • Monitor overtime weekly to ensure profit goals are met or exceeded.

  • Maintain a safe working environment and educate & train on safety practices/procedures.

  • Assist culinary associates as needed to ensure production is complete prior to each service/function.

  • Direct and supervise cooks and stewards on an as needed basis.

  • Demonstrate a thorough knowledge of food handling and preparation techniques.

  • Store, rotate and label food items and maintain a well sanitized kitchen in accordance with health regulations.

  • Work closely with purchasing to stay current on new products that can improve quality and/or lower costs.

  • Stay current with hotel and culinary trends to provide innovative menu ideas.

  • Participate in the demonstration kitchen series.

Skills/Requirements

  • A graduate of a culinary institute with an associate degree highly desired or completion of equivalent apprenticeship program, certified through the American Culinary Federation.

  • Food Manager Certification required or completion of this certificate within six months of employment.

  • Requires clear, concise written and verbal communication skills, strong technical skills, excellent time management skills, strong organizational skills, excellent safety and sanitation skills and creative problem solving skills.

  • Experience in budgeting, food cost, labor costs, and scheduling.

  • Minimum of 4-5 years of practical restaurant management experience or related resort hotel experience.

  • Thorough knowledge of food handling and preparation techniques.

  • Skilled in inventory control.

The salary range for this position is $57,700 - $74,100. The specific salary offered to a candidate may be influenced by a variety of factors including the candidate’s experience, their education, and the work location. Available benefits include medical, dental, vision & 401k.
